<p><span style=color: rgba(15 60 81 1)>On the second to last day of summer school in 1984 Calvin and Jason Schott hijack a school bus carrying nineteen students an unthinkable act of violence that devastates the&nbsp;community of Brookwood. Thirty years later twin sisters and survivors of the ordeal Brenda and Emily Mashburn are forced to relive the kidnapping as they film a documentary about the event in an attempt to thwart Calvin's looming parole hearing. Meanwhile Jason fights for his brother's release hoping that a reunited family can finally bring peace to their elderly mother and ease the guilt he feels over his role in the kidnapping. The result is a feud between the two families with neither side willing to back down.</span></p><p><br></p><p><span style=color: rgba(15 60 81 1)><span>?</span>Inspired by the largest kidnapping-for-ransom scheme in American history </span><em style=color: rgba(15 60 81 1)>Time Will Break the World</em><span style=color: rgba(15 60 81 1)> weaves a rich backdrop of place and circumstance-long-term trauma dysfunctional family legacies sibling rivalry a granite quarry and the Los Angeles Summer Olympics.</span></p>
